Output e94f94a0113ee3220c05dccb70f3533968d36022f1eb6682f8516cf34f4e3dc2:9

value
31353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f8a307511ce3b7fc59b17be839b43d9f636b77 OP_EQUAL
address
34Ev2K7E9qaMpwgwSydJL7KxUyKgWnA5kX
transaction
e94f94a0113ee3220c05dccb70f3533968d36022f1eb6682f8516cf34f4e3dc2